I’ve written about Ning in the past. The general ideas is briliant: create a few plug’n'play building blocks, invite deveopers to join for free and let them create their own mashup of functionality. True modular web service creation, with reduced development time - sometimes all it takes is 5-15 minutes to put something together.
Well they’ve added a few more modules that you can use to build your own photo-sharing or video-sharing site. There’s also a module for creating a social network. So you can combine these and older modules to come up with some fairly interesting combinations. Older modules …

One of the obviously great things about the Internet is that there are unlimited, innovative ways for people to interact with each other. Right now, one of the popular ways is social bookmarking. Social bookmarking sites like Del.icio.us, and Digg are wildly popular, and could be what a blogger needs to increase their profile and web traffic. Related sites like Newsvine go one step further and include both reader-submitted stories and original newswire content.
While there are several purposes for social bookmarking sites, sharing stories and gaining traffic are some of the reasons bloggers should look into them. …
